Pacira BioSciences Debuts Inspiring New Film Highlighting One Patient’s Journey to Pain Relief and Innovation in Care at BIO 2025
PaciraPacira(US:PCRX) Globenewswire·2025-06-18 12:00

Core Insights - Pacira BioSciences, Inc. is focusing on non-opioid pain therapies to improve patient outcomes and reduce opioid dependency [1][4] - The film "The Next Frontier: Mark & Leah's Story" showcases the personal journey of Mark Allen, who overcame opioid dependency through non-opioid treatments [2][3] - The opioid crisis remains a significant public health issue, with chronic pain affecting approximately 82 million Americans and costing the U.S. up to $635 billion annually [4] Company Overview - Pacira offers three commercial-stage non-opioid treatments: EXPAREL, ZILRETTA, and iovera°, aimed at managing pain without opioids [5] - EXPAREL is a long-acting local analgesic approved for various pain management applications, while ZILRETTA is for osteoarthritis knee pain, and iovera° provides drug-free pain control [5] - The company is also developing PCRX-201, a gene therapy targeting prevalent diseases like osteoarthritis [5] Industry Context - The U.S. experienced approximately 80,391 drug overdose deaths in 2024, with opioid-related deaths decreasing to 54,743, indicating a need for alternative pain management solutions [4] - Despite the decline in opioid-related deaths, the overall opioid crisis continues to have a severe impact on public health [4] - Investment in novel pain treatments has decreased, highlighting the urgent need for innovative non-opioid therapies [4]
